Transaction 99bd3579c74352499ded6af2e329a4127f6cf07dc1e6d1ce8d80b9b6bc220c4b

2 Input
2 Outputs
  • 99bd3579c74352499ded6af2e329a4127f6cf07dc1e6d1ce8d80b9b6bc220c4b:0
  • value  52505533
    address  1Aczzjfrz38iYFpWrjScEuSASB1JxPkQVk
  • 99bd3579c74352499ded6af2e329a4127f6cf07dc1e6d1ce8d80b9b6bc220c4b:1
  • value  24815
    address  14emruxYdzaBEVWa9iRaW7gCg7QscyCx4H